Henry paused when she stopped, allowing several feet to span between them, his gaze travelling over her figure. She was tense with some hidden trouble he didn't know about, some secret tribulation that pulled her to the edges of civilization.
He was giving her a wide berth, the kind you might give a dangerous animal. Not that he considered her to be such because of her race. Merely because of her demeanor. Something about her felt threatening, even though she did not pull a knife on him or turn to threaten his safety. Even when she only demanded to know why he wanted to help, he remained rigid, a shadow against the canopy of hills and their scattered trees.
"That's a fair question," he swallowed, eyes moving back up to her suspicious expression. He found her face to be beautiful, in a rather deadly way. His hands, splayed, were presented in an attempt to appease her, to show that he was of no threat. "I don't have any ulterior motives, if that's what you mean. I just want to help if and where I can," his words resolved as he spoke, considering that he spoke truthfully.
He lowered his arms and tipped his head down to ask gently, "Who are you looking for?" If he had more information, that'd be a lot better than shooting into the dark; it'd help him help her.
